/* main positions */
#top	{	visibility: visible;	position: absolute; top:  75px; left:  33px; 	}
#menue	{	visibility: visible;	position: absolute; top: 133px; left:  28px; width: 180px;	}
#inhalt	{	visibility: visible;	position: relative; top:  30px; left: 245px; width: 550px; background-color:F7F7EC;  border:1px solid #1A284B;z-index:5;}

#contentBottom	{	visibility: visible;	position: relative; top:  0px; left: 245px; width: 550px;}
#rootline{	visibility: visible;	position: absolute; top:  60px; left: 285px; width: 468px; z-index:6;}
#address{	visibility: visible;	position: absolute; top:  92px; left: 824px; width: 180px; z-index:7; color:#56470A;;}

#inhaltTable {	margin:15px;	width:520px;	}

#rootline a	{	font-weight:bold;	}
#rootline 	{	font-weight:bold;	}
#inhalt a 	{	color:#56470A;	}

#inhaltInner {	background-color:#FFFFFF;
				border:1px solid #1A284B;
				padding:22;
				padding-top:45px;
}

div.contentRight .content_0, #contentBottom .content_0{
	font-size:12px;
	line-height: 14px;
}

/*.imgtext-nowrap td{white-space:nowrap;}*/

body	{	background-color:	#f7f6f2; margin:0px;}

.contentBorder	{	background-color:	#f7f7ec; }

body,td,div, span.norm	{	color:	#333333; 
			font:	14px Times New Roman,Times,Garamond,serif; 
			line-height:20px;
		}
/* headline */
h1	{font-size:	16px;
		font-weight:bold;	
		}


.header{font-size:	28px;
		font-weight:bold;	
		margin-bottom:-20px;		
		}
.headersub{font-size:	14px;
		margin-bottom:-20px;		
		}

a{		color:#56470A;
		text-decoration:	none;
		font-weight:	normal;
}

a:active {		color:				black;
				background-color:	#fafafa; 
		}

a:visited {		color:	#675b2b;}
a:hover {		color:	#7f6600;}


div#menue a {	color:		#56470A;	}


.celmenu:hover, .searchresultpagetitle:hover, :loginform{	color: #0055A9; }


.m0a, .m1a, .m2a, .m3a	{	
			text-decoration:underline;
			background-image:url(grafik/point_curr.gif);
			background-repeat:no-repeat;
			}
			
.m0,.m0a	{	margin-left:	0px;	text-indent:	10px;  }
.m1,.m1a	{	margin-left:	15px;	text-indent:	10px; }
.m2,.m2a	{	margin-left:	30px;	text-indent:	10px; }
.m3,.m3a	{	margin-left:	45px;	text-indent:	10px; }

/*.imgtext-nowrap{width:100%;}*/

b		{	font-weight: bold;	} 

.note	{	color: #999999; 
			font-weight: bold;
			} 

li			{ 	text-indent:	-30px;
				padding-left:	-40px; }

td			{	vertical-align:top;
				}

p,br		{	line-height:	20px; 
				padding:		0px;	
				margin:			0px;
				}

hr			{	background-color: gray;
				height:	1px; 
				color: black;
				border:		1px;	
				margin-top:			12px;
				}



#klein, .klein	{	font: 12px;color:gray; }


.bild		{	font-size:	12px;
				line-height:12px;
				color:		#999999;
			}

.note	{	font-size:	10px;	}

.rechts	{	text-align:	right;	}

.schraeg	{	font-style: italic;	}

.line		{	background-image:	url(/fileadmin/templates/grafik/line.gif);
				background-repeat:	repeat-x;
				background-position:bottom;
			}

.div		{	border: 1px black;	}

.printLink { color:#aaaaaa; font-size:11px;}
.content_1 {color:black;border: 1px solid black; padding:6px;text-align:justify;margin-bottom:10px; background-color:#eeeeee;}
.content_2 {background-color:black; color:#ffffff; padding:6px;text-align:justify;margin-bottom:10px;}

.suchtitel {width: 200px; height: 20px;	margin-bottom:1px; white-space: nowrap; overflow: hidden}


#contentBottom .content_0 p	{	color: #999999; line-height: 13px;}
#contentBottom .content_0 a	{	 color: #999999;}

